Mihai Cimpoi

Mihai Cimpoi is the author and developer of the long-term project "The World Congress of Eminescologists", launched in 2012 and became a tradition.

[5] The future academician, after primary and secondary education, graduated from the Faculty of Philology from Chișinău (1965), after which he became the editor of the magazine "Nistru" (until 1972) and a consultant of the Union of Writers.

In 1973, his signature and public activity are forbidden, because he "dared" to address the aesthetic critique of the Călinescian origin instead of the official, sociologistic.

Since May 1987 he has been elected secretary of the Steering Committee of the Writers' Union of Moldova and president since September 1991 until 2010.

In parallel, he is the head of the Department of Classical Literature of the Institute of History and Literary Theory of the Academy of Sciences of Moldova, he obtained his Ph.D. in Philology in 1998, with the thesis "Eminescu, poet of Being" (conductor, Eugen Simion) and teaches at the "Ion Creangă" Pedagogical University in Chişinău.
